Attention-Deficit/Hyperactivity Disorder

Attention-deficit/hyperactivity disorder (ADHD) is a neurodevelopmental disorder characterized by persistent inattention, hyperactivity, and impulsivity. It affects approximately 5-8% of children globally, with around 60-70% of cases persisting into adulthood. ADHD has significant implications for educational attainment, social interactions, and occupational success.
Diagnostic Criteria and Symptoms
To diagnose ADHD, symptoms must manifest before age 12 and be evident across multiple settings.

[Executive function training in attention deficit hyperactivity disorder].

Luis Abad-Mas1, Rosalía Ruiz-Andrés, Francisca Moreno-Madrid

  • 1RED-CENIT, Centro de Neurodesarrollo Interdisciplinar, Valencia, Spain. lam@red-cenit.com

Revista De Neurologia
|March 3, 2011
PubMed
Summary

Understanding attention deficit hyperactivity disorder (ADHD) involves recognizing its core deficits. This study explores neurobiological syndromes to improve cognitive functions like attention and working memory in children with ADHD.

Area of Science:

  • Neuroscience
  • Psychology

Context:

  • Attention deficit hyperactivity disorder (ADHD) presents challenges in attention, inhibitory control, cognitive flexibility, and working memory.
  • Existing treatments for ADHD lack sufficient focus on improving these core cognitive mechanisms.

Purpose:

  • To deepen the understanding of ADHD by exploring its underlying neurobiological syndromes.
  • To review current proposals for enhancing cognitive functions in children with ADHD.

Summary:

  • This work reviews current proposals for improving cognitive functions in ADHD.
  • It examines three key neurobiological syndromes associated with ADHD: medial cingulate, dorsolateral, and orbitofrontal syndromes.
  • A comprehensive understanding of these deficits is crucial for developing effective ADHD treatment models.

Impact:

  • Advances in neuroscientific research and computerized tools can significantly enhance psychopedagogical and neuropsychological interventions for ADHD.
  • This research provides valuable data on the temporal and spatial aspects of ADHD, aiding in improved treatment outcomes.
